Acute Care Nurse Practitioner

Ms. Kristina Reavis is an Acute Care Nurse Practitioner in Pueblo, CO with special training and skill in diagnosing and treating a variety of acute but severe illnesses, sometimes over long periods. As an Acute Care Nurse Practitioner, Kristina Reavis, APN performs treatment for critically ill patients. Acute Care Nurse Practice is practiced in emergency rooms, urgent care centers, intensive care units, surgical units, and nursing homes. Significant diseases and conditions treated by Acute Care Nurse Practitioners include flu complications, broken bones, concussions, heart attacks, seizures, or shock.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Acute Care Nurse Practitioners include ordering and performing diagnostic tests, creating treatment plans, applying sutures and splinting broken bones, prescribing medication, monitoring treatments and medical equipment, referring patients to specialists, collaborating with specialists, and discharging patients.

Family Nurse Practitioner

Ms. Kristina Reavis is a Family Nurse Practitioner in Pueblo, CO with special training and skill in family-centric general health care. As a Family Nurse Practitioner, Kristina Reavis, APN performs preventative, diagnostic and treatment procedures for a variety of acute and chronic diseases, conditions, and injuries. Family Nurse Practice is an advanced practice registered nurse who works autonomously or in collaboration with other healthcare professionals to deliver family-oriented care. Significant diseases and conditions treated by Family Nurse Practitioners include cold and flu, infections, high blood pressure, hormone imbalance, hepatitis, diabetes, lacerations or minor trauma, and sexually transmitted diseases.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Family Nurse Practitioners include medical history analysis, physical exams, diagnostic testing, nutrition and treatment plan development, hormone balancing, immunization delivery, wound suturing and removal, and patient education.
